The renderer's coordinate system, zoom tiers, and accessibility-overlay hooks each have subtleties that trip up first-time plugin authors — particularly how balcony sections are projected onto the flattened canvas for the Pellam Theatre layouts. Our team maintains an extended guide covering the plugin lifecycle, sandbox restrictions, and a worked example of a custom pricing overlay. You can find that guide at the following internal page.

wiki page, tahaf-tajog: https://jira.ordindyn.corp/pipeline

Runbook: EXIF scrubbing pipeline (plugin authors)

All images ingested through the Lanternframe plugin API must pass through the scrub stage before storage. The scrubber strips EXIF location, device, and timestamp fields, then writes a sanitized copy and an audit row. Do not bypass the audit write; compliance checks depend on it. If scrub jobs stall, inspect the audit queue table first. The audit database is reachable via the connection string below.

warehouse DSN: mssql://belion_svc:6e@db-785f.paliqworks.corp:5432/ulaax

**Vendor note: Inkmill markdown pipeline**

Rendering for Parchway docs is outsourced to Inkmill under an annual contract, renewing each March. They handle sanitization and PDF export; we own the upload queue. SLA: 4-hour response on rendering failures. Escalate only after two failed retries. Their support desk is reachable at the address below.

billing contact of hahaf-baguf = zorael.tammir.jorius@sivrelhq.internal